Need a full new set of tools and after 15 years of manual labour and some physical issues including carpal tunnel syndrome I'm hoping to go for battery powered with the battery on the back to reduce weight and vibes on the hands. I've demoed the Pellenc stuff and liked it on the whole, especially the blower, strimmer was a bit heavy hanging on the same harness as the battery, hedge cutter good but could be a bit more robust battery lasted me more than a day. But quote has come in at £4000 for the kit! The Stihl stuff seems to be a fair bit cheaper but I've not been able to demo it.Is anyone using either of these set ups? Feedback appreciated.

      Hello,

      As David says i have been using Pellenc for four years. I am very impressed on the whole. Still on the original battery (4 years old) and only minor items replaced such as strimmer head support cup, chains etc. I don't use it all day every day but must get 4 hrs use a day with various tools. Strimmer (1200) is probably the only tool i am not 100% happy with. My health and productivity has increased because of less weight, vibrations, noise and the fact there are no emissions at point of use.

      Price is an issue for many but you have to look at it long term together with non monetary advantages like health, productivity, no fuel to buy and mix, no servicing and starting problems.

      I have not used the stihl or husqy battery tools so can not comment on them, sorry.
